Cooking Ingredients for Maple, Wheat And Oat Bread for Machine Recipe
1-1/4 c Warm water; 110 to 115
-degrees
2 tb Maple syrup
2-1/4 c Bread flour
1/2 c Whole-wheat bread flour
1/4 c Old-fashioned rolled oats
1-1/2 ts Salt
1-1/2 ts Bread-machine yeast; or
-rapid-rise yeast
Maple, Wheat And Oat Bread for Machine Preparation
1. Measure all ingredients in order listed into mixing container of bread machine. If your machine requires that liquid ingredients be added last, simply reverse order. Program machine according to manufacturer”s directions for basic loaf of bread, medium darkness. Makes 1 loaf, 1 1/2 pounds, 16 slices. Per slice: 88 calories, 0.33g fat, no cholesterol, 1.2g fiber, 134mg sodium. Calories from fat: 3%. TESTED* by Sheri Beronja-Schlitt. I was afraid the texture would be bad because of the lack of fat, she wrote. I was wrong. The bread was flavorful and richly textured. The top was flat, rather than rounded. The crust was wonderful, lightly crispy. Our kids do not like the thick crust that develops in a bread maker – this crust they ate. It was easy to prepare and tasty. Our family gobbled up the entire 1 1/2 pound loaf at one meal. Recipe from Light and Easy Baking by Beatrice Ojakangas (Clarkson Potter, 1996). *Low-fat recipes are home tested by a panel of Food Section readers: Milwaukee Journal Sentinel 1997.
